Після придбання плати Ардуіно Про Міні деякі користувачі стикаються з проблемою прошивки, так як, щоб прошити цю плату, необхідно купити ще спеціальний програматор. У зв’язку з цим, ви зацікавитесь, як можна прошити плату без програматора? На щастя, зробити це досить просто. У цій статті докладно розглянемо, як прошити або перепрошити Arduino Pro Mini. Давайте розбиратися. Поїхали!
Розглянемо, як перепрошити Arduino Pro Mini
Для перепрошивки вам знадобиться Ардуіно Uno. Насамперед потрібно з’єднати GND з землею, UCC — з плюсом, RXI і NX0 з такими ж входами на Uno, а GRN — з reset. Найкраще буде подати трёхвольтное напруга. При подачі живлення на платі загориться червоний індикатор. Не забудьте попередньо дістати з Uno контролер ATMEGA.
Тепер необхідно підключити плату до комп’ютера. Потім запустіть на своєму ПК Sketch. Перебуваючи в головному вікні утиліти, відкрийте меню «Файл» і натисніть на пункт «Приклади», далі наведіть курсор на розділ «Basics» і в списку натисніть «Blink». Після цього перейдіть до верхньої панелі і відкрийте меню «Сервис». Виберіть в ньому пункт «Плата». У списку плат необхідно буде зазначити рядок «Arduino Pro Mini (5V, 16MHz) w / ATmega328» замість тієї, що зазначена за замовчуванням. Також не забудьте вказати в налаштуваннях необхідний com-порт.
Потім натисніть кнопку «Завантажити» в програмі. Як тільки в нижньому рядку з’явиться слово «завантаження», натисніть на платі «reset». На екрані ви побачите повідомлення про те, що завантаження завершено. Готово. Перепрошивка успішно виконана.
Тепер розглянемо, як зробити те ж саме, тільки через Nano. Відкрийте Sketch і перейдіть в меню «Файл», виберіть розділ «Зразки». У списку клікніть по «ArduinoISP». Потім потрібно зайти в «Інструменти», вибрати пункт «Плата» і відзначити «Arduino Nano».
Виконайте прошивку Nano за допомогою скетчу ArduinoISP. Перевірте швидкість порту в функції setup. Саме такий буде швидкість під час прошивки Pro Mini. У стандартному Sketch швидкість дорівнює 19200.
Підготувавши Nano, приступайте до збірки breadboard, щоб перепрошити Про Міні. Підключіть + 5V до Vcc, GND з’єднайте з таким же входом, D10 з RST, а D11, D12 і D13 з аналогічними входами на Pro Mini.
Тепер необхідно підключити Nano до ПК. Перш ніж приступити до перепрошивки, переконайтеся, що у вас використовуються рівні швидкості порту, орієнтуючись на швидкість з Sketch. Пошукайте текстовий файл «boards» в папці «arduino». Відкривши його, знайдіть рядок:
pro5v328.name = Arduino Pro Mini (5V, 16 MHz) w / ATmega328
Якщо ви використовуєте іншу версію, виберіть відповідну. Перевірте задану швидкість. Також слід перевірити настройки в текстовому файлі «programmers».
Якщо з настройками все в порядку, запустіть / перезапустите IDE. Після цього перейдіть в меню «Інструменти» і вкажіть плату, яку потрібно прошити разом з типом програматора «Arduino as ISP».
На наступному кроці потрібно відкрити розділ «Файл» і клікнути по пункту «вгруз через програматор». Так само, як і в вищерозглянутому випадку, необхідно натиснути на платі кнопку «reset», щоб успішно виконати перепрошивання. Усе. Готово.